| 751740 | 2009-02-27 02:54:00 | Hi there - i need to upgrade my 19" LCD for my PC, any advice on good ones to look at - i play a lot of games Cheers I would recommend the dell 2408, as it is a very nice monitor and I got mine for about $800. It however may not be as good as others for games, as I believe the cheaper TN panels are better for game. However due to the low exchange rate, and the interest rate cuts, it has risen in price to about $1200. Nice monitor though. I would recommend getting a monitor now from a retailer with existin gstock at a lower price, as they will go up in price when retailers buy them at the new excahnge rate prices. |
